End of the Year - What do you do to wrap up?

Final game tomorrow......got me to thinking what everyone else does when their season is over.

For me:

1. Take shirts and pants to dry cleaners (I like putting my shirts and pants away in the closet in those plastic bags)

2. Double check mileage log and ensure I have been paid for all games

3. Update pre-game notes

4. Fill out my March Madness Bracket

I'm assuming it's his running list of "things to make sure we cover in the pregame conversation". Makes sense to me... I don't personally have a written list, but I probably should.

Basically, I put all my basketball gear away, get out my baseball and football gear (spring practices/scrimmages at the various local colleges, plus a clinic in early April), start working on my baseball rules test, and make a note of what gear I'll need to buy for next season (2 pairs of pants, at least one shirt, 2 new whistles).

Maybe this year I'll even get to a summer clinic... that's been on the list for a few years now.
